Edenville Flood Residents’ Class Action Against Michigan

State of Michigan · Dam safety regulation and emergency response · Dismissed

About this case

Midland County residents alleged that the State of Michigan failed to take adequate action after identifying safety concerns at the Edenville Dam, contributing to property damage and other losses from the 2020 flood. The residents’ class action seeking compensation was dismissed in April 2026, and the residents’ attorneys said they planned to appeal.
